Gem Training Institute

was started by an individual who saw an untapped potential in the Health Promotion education industry.This potential was in creating a new low cost position while still being able to compete with the larger companies on quality.

This strategy would be created through strategic alliances and partnerships of local communities. The company has seen steady growth in a mature market which is a sign of the firm’s viable business strategy. The company has no investors. GEM Training Institute is incorporated as a private company registered with CIPC.

GEM Training Institute is a Skills Development Provider specialising in helping its clients to develop and improve their skills and marketability.

GEM Training Institute exist to make tangible difference to its clients’ efficiency and their ability to contribute positively in the economy.

The drive behind this is passion for quality skills development coupled with studies in the field of health industry management.

This is also backed by 20 years of working experience in Health industry, community development, HIV/Aids management, property management, ICT and telecoms.

GEM Training Institute aspire to be the partner of choice in solving skills development challenges through diagnosis, identifying, development plan, implementing operational engagement in order to achieve its partners objectives
